For decades, Hindi music lovers have settled for convenience over quality. We moved from cassette tapes and CDs to compressed MP3s, and eventually to standard streaming algorithms. While platforms like YouTube and early streaming apps made Bollywood music accessible anywhere, they stripped away the soul of the audio through heavy data compression.
In the modern era of digital consumption, the way we experience art is often dictated by convenience rather than quality. For decades, the standard for listening to Hindi film music—the lifeblood of Indian popular culture—was the compressed MP3 format. It was small, portable, and easily shared. However, as technology has evolved and storage space has ceased to be a limiting factor, a quiet revolution has taken place. Audiophiles and casual listeners alike are rediscovering the rich tapestry of Bollywood soundtracks through lossless audio. While compressed formats serve the utilitarian purpose of background noise, Hindi lossless tracks stand as the superior medium for consumption, offering a trifecta of benefits: the restoration of historical recording integrity, the preservation of dynamic range essential to Indian classical instrumentation, and an immersive emotional resonance that compressed audio simply cannot replicate.
